Choosing the Right Shade of Brown

When selecting a brown couch for your living room, it's essential to choose the right shade of brown to match your desired aesthetic. Consider the color temperature of the brown, as well as the undertones. Here are a few popular shades of brown and their associated styles:

  • Warm brown (also known as chocolate brown): A warm and inviting shade reminiscent of chocolate, this brown is perfect for cozy, traditional, and vintage-inspired spaces.
  • Cool brown (also known as taupe): A mix of brown and gray, this color is ideal for modern, minimalist, and sophisticated designs.
  • Neutral brown: A balanced mix of warm and cool undertones, this shade is versatile and easy to pair with various color schemes.
  • Walnut brown: A darker, richer brown with a reddish undertone, this shade is perfect for luxurious, elegant, and high-end spaces.

Pairing Brown with Complementary Colors

Pairing brown with complementary colors can add depth and visual interest to your living room. Here are some popular color combinations to try: • Neutral color schemes: + White: A classic combination that creates a clean and airy feel. This is perfect for small, compact living spaces. + Beige: A gentle, earthy combination ideal for creating a peaceful and soothing ambiance. + Cream: A soft, inviting combination that works well for traditional and vintage-inspired designs. • + Coral: A bright, playful combination that's perfect for fun and energetic spaces. + Red: A bold, dramatic combination that's ideal for statement-making living rooms. + Yellow: A vibrant, sunny combination that's perfect for lively and airy spaces. Here are some tips for incorporating bold colors with your brown couch:

  • Start with a bold accent piece, such as an oversized piece of artwork or an eye-catching throw pillow, to create a striking focal point in the room.
  • Balance bold colors with neutral elements to avoid visual overload.
  • Consider the 60-30-10 rule: 60% neutral elements, 30% secondary elements, and 10% bold accent pieces.

Adding Patterns and Textures

Adding patterns and textures can elevate your living room design and create visual interest. Consider incorporating one or more of the following elements to complement your brown couch: • Patterned throw pillows: Add a vintage rug, a botanical print, or a geometric pattern to create a cohesive look and add personality to your space. | Pattern | Description | Suggestions | | --- | --- | --- | | Geometric | A bold, geometric pattern that can add visual interest | Geometric-shaped vases, throw pillows, or rugs | | Striped | A classic, striped pattern that's perfect for bohemian-inspired spaces | Striped throw pillows, blankets, or a striped rug | | Floral | A delicate, floral pattern that's ideal for feminine and elegant spaces | Floral-patterned throw pillows, blankets, or a floral-print rug |
